WebOblique fractures usually affect long bones in your body. Some of the most common include: Femur (thigh). Tibia (shin). Fibula (calf). Humerus (upper arm). Radius and ulna (forearm). Clavicle (collarbone). Oblique fractures are almost always caused by falls or other traumas. You might need surgery to repair your bone. WebFeb 15, 2024 · Between 2015 and 2024, 17 distal diaphyseal humeral fractures in 17 consecutive patients (14 men, 3 women, mean age 38 years) were operated on with a long “Y-shaped” dorsal plate. There were two bifocal fractures and 11 diaphyso-metaphyseal fractures with butterfly fragments.
